| 1 | teaspoon | water | cold |
| 1 | each | egg white | |
| 1 | pound | pecan halves | large |
| 1 | cup | sugar | |
| 1 | teaspoon | cinnamon | ground |
| 1 | teaspoon | salt |
Beat water and egg white until frothy.
Mix well with pecans.
Combine sugar, cinnamon and salt.
Mix well with pecans.
Spread on cookie sheet.
Bake at 225 degrees F for 1 hour.
Stir occasionally.
